    Frequently asked questions

    How much do Child, Family, and School Social Workers make per hour in Las Vegas?

    The median hourly wage for Child, Family, and School Social Workers in Las Vegas, NV is $29.05, based on BLS OEWS 2025 data. Top earners (90th percentile) make $48.11 or more per hour.

    Is Las Vegas above or below average for Child, Family, and School Social Workers salaries?

    The median Child, Family, and School Social Workers salary in Las Vegas, NV is 3.2% above the national median of $58,570. The national figure is from BLS OEWS 2025 data covering all US metropolitan areas.

    What is the entry-level salary for Child, Family, and School Social Workers in Las Vegas?

    Entry-level Child, Family, and School Social Workers (10th percentile) earn around $44,750 per year in Las Vegas, NV. The 25th percentile — typically workers with 1–3 years of experience — earn approximately $48,300.
